Ex-pre-school teacher admits ill-treating four children
The Straits Times
|March 06, 2025
A former pre-school teacher employed by Kinderland has admitted to ill-treating the children under her charge, with acts that included squeezing open the mouths of two children to force-feed them water.
Lin Min pleaded guilty on March 5 to three counts of ill-treating a child.
The court heard she had abused a total of four children, who were between one and three years old at the time. Three other similar charges will be taken into consideration for her sentencing, which is slated for March 13.
The Mandarin teacher, 35, has since been fired by the school.
The case made headlines in 2023 when videos of the abuse taken by another teacher were uploaded on social media.
Deputy Public Prosecutor Jotham Tay said Lin began working as a pre-school teacher in March 2020.
Her first victim, referred to in court documents as V1, was a year and 10 months old when the incident happened.
The victims cannot be named due to a gag order protecting their identities.
In June 2023, Lin saw V1's water bottle was full and realised she had not been drinking water.
She tried to get the girl to drink her water, but when she refused, Lin grabbed her by her arms and pushed her down on the floor.
